
Fremont, Neb. – Dakota Wesleyan men's basketball rallied back from four down at the half to grab one last win on the road in the 2021-22 regular season. Koln Oppold goes for a season-high 33-points.
The Quick Details
Score:
DWU 76 – MU 75
Records:
DWU 12-13 Overall (GPAC 9-9)
MU 14-14 Overall (GPAC 5-13)
How It Happened
- The Tigers fell behind early into the game 5-2 after Midland kicked things off with two baskets in a row.
- After missed shots from deep by the Warriors, DWU climbed back within one point (8-7) as Jeffrey Schuch collected on a three-pointer.
- Dakota Wesleyan continued to battle with Midland after five minutes into the game as Koln Oppold makes a layup giving the Tigers their first lead of the game 9-8 with 14:49 still to play in the first.
- The DWU lead was short-lived as Midland went on a 13-3 run for the 21-12 lead over the Tigers and forced a Tiger timeout with 11-minutes to play.
- Dakota Wesleyan came out of the timeout putting together a 7-0 run, closing the Warriors lead to 21-19, which forced a Midland timeout.
- As the Tigers and Warriors crossed eight minutes to play in the first half, DWU tied the game at 21-21, then Midland converted on one of two free throws for the lead 22-21, then DWU took the lead back at 23-22 as Mason Larson hit a jump shot.
- The Warriors went scoreless for over three minutes while the Tigers were held scoreless for over four minutes.
- In the final 78-seconds of the first half, Midland pushed the lead out to four after converting on three free throws, 31-27.
- Dakota Wesleyan came out in the second half making back-to-back baskets for the 32-31 lead.
- Once again, the DWU lead was short-lived as Midland made a jumper on the opposite end for the one-point lead.
- Oppold hit shots on two trips down the floor with a jumper to bring the Tigers within two, then a shot beyond the arc giving DWU the 39-38 lead.
- After four ties in as many minutes Schuch ended the streak with a layup for the 50-48 lead, followed by Oppold on the next trip down the court for the 53-48 lead.
- With eight minutes left in regulation, Midland climbed back within two points 57-55 before Oppold hit another shot from beyond the arc for the five-point lead.
- After four baskets in a row from Oppold, Dakota Wesleyan recorded their largest lead of the game 71-61 with 3:22 left to play.
- Oppold collects the final two Tiger baskets to lead 76-70 with 30-seconds left in the second half.
- But the Warriors were not done yet as they hit a shot from deep, cutting the DWU lead to 76-73 with 23-seconds left.
- Then dropping the DWU lead to one point 76-75 and missing the game-winning shot for the final score of Tigers 76 Warriors 75.
- As a team, the Tigers shot 54.4% from the floor, 40% beyond the arc, and 85.7% at the free-throw line; while the Warriors shot 44.6% from the field, 31% from distance, and 84.2% at the foul line.
- DWU outrebounds Midland 32-25 as both teams tallied nine assists.
- Tigers score 38 points in the paint compared to the 24 points in the paint by the Warriors.
Beyond The Results
- Koln Oppold: 33 points,77.7 FG%, 66.6 3-pt%, one-of-one free throw shooting, and nine rebounds.
- Jeffrey Schuch: 21 points, 71.4 FG%, one-of-one beyond the arc, six rebounds, and five assists.
- Sawyer Schultz: 12 points 40 FG%, 50 3-pt%, two-of-two free throw shooting, and three rebounds.
